GEORGE NEWS - A group of over 200 members of the South African Municipal Workers Union (Samwu) are making their way to the George Municipality’s main building in town to hand over a memorandum of grievances.
Outstanding Covid-19 compensation funds, the TASK Job Evaluation system used by the municipality and unilateral restructuring are some of the issues they want to address, said Samwu’s Provincial Secretary John Mcanjana.
“The TASK Job Evaluation are manipulated to benefit only senior management and ordinary workers are suffering,” he said.
“Unilateral restructuring is looking at face value instead of addressing serious service delivery challenges, including the exploitation of EPWP and Contract workers.”
